Quickie: It's A Boy!!


Wednesday R&B singer Usher and his wife Tameka Raymond welcomed their second child into the world - a boy!


The new youngster will be the Raymonds' second son together. Tameka has three other sons.

Usher Needs His Momma!


So R&B sensation Usher has finally snapped back to reality with the fact that his career is not doing as well as it should be doing.


So what does Usher do in a situation like this??..


I glad you asked...He fires his whole management team of course!


He also fired his publicist as well.


So now you're asking who did he hire???


He's called on Jonetta Patton (aka MOM) to come back on board and pick up all the slack.


Here's what Benny Medina - who managed Tyra Banks, Mariah Carey and Jennifer Lopez had to say about the split:



"With an artist like Usher, the bar is set really high. Whether it was management, marketing or the music, we achieved a number one single and a number one album. It is a completely new day and time in music now. In four years, his audience, demographic, and musical direction has changed. Records like Lil Wayne's 'Lollipop' are the type of phenomena that 'Yeah' was in 2004."
